Chaz Bono's Fiancee Horrified at Death Threats He's Received (VIDEO)
by Jason Hughes, posted Nov 28th 2011 4:30AM
This week's installment of 'Being Chaz' (Sun., 8PM ET on OWN) took us back to the fallout from the announcement that Chaz Bono would be joining this latest season of 'Dancing With the Stars.' His fiancée Jennifer Elia was shocked and horrified at some of the comments that came through Twitter.It is amazing how much hatred some people can have in their hearts. Certainly, the Internet has made it easier for these people to spew some of the most horrific and terrifying bile toward others, and Bono received plenty, including threats of physical violence and death.
"I don't think its worth it to do this show if he's gonna get shot," Elia said. "I don't want him to die for a cause."

What's Next for Chaz Bono? A Follow-Up to 'Becoming Chaz' on OWN
by Catherine Lawson, posted Oct 27th 2011 7:45AM
Chaz Bono's got time on his hands now that he's been eliminated from 'Dancing With the Stars,' but he won't be off TV screens for long. OWN has announced that it will air a follow-up special to 'Becoming Chaz' on November 27.'Being Chaz' follows Bono and his fiancée Jennifer Elia as they navigate life after his gender reassignment surgery. We'll see her getting used to living with a man and him preparing to compete on 'Dancing With the Stars.' The documentary is executive produced by the veteran reality team of Fenton Bailey and Randy Barbato ('Million Dollar Listing,' 'The Strange History of Don't Ask Don't Tell'), with Elise Duran ('Millionaire Matchmaker') as director and co-executive producer.
OWN will air a second special focusing on issues affecting the transgender community after 'Being Chaz.' 'I Am Jazz: A Family in Transition' follows 11-year-old transgender Jazz and her family wrestling with life-altering decisions as Jazz approaches puberty.
